Dr. Jimmie A. Ellis, Ill the dynamic Senior Pastor of Victory Christian Center, is both recognized and respected for his standard of excellence in ministry. He is a highly sought after speaker who is anointed in the areas of teaching, leadership, mentoring and fatherhood.
Dr. Ellis possesses an extraordinary revelation of the Word of God. His dynamic yet practical teaching style has led many to give their lives to Jesus Christ. His life-changing teachings on holy living, home and marriage, purpose and financial freedom are empowering generations.

Raised in the Mount Olive Apostolic Church, under the pastorship of Dr, John Myers, Dr. Ellis accepted Jesus at the age of nine. By age twelve, Dr. Ellis began teaching Bible study. In 1983, he was released to pastor. He then founded the Bible Enlightenment Christian Center with just 7 members. Today that humble beginning is known as Victory Christian Center, a thriving ministry located in the heart of Southwest Philadelphia a membership of over 2,000. Today, under the covering of Bishop Don Meares of Evangel Temple in Upper Marlboro, MD, Dr. Ellis serves on the Advisory Board of the International Congress of Local Churches (ICLC).

Having a heart for leaders, Dr. Ellis formulated the Victory Fellowship of Local Churches to provide pastors with mentoring, building church leadership and forming a network of covenant relationships with like-minded men and women of God. His annual leadership conferences and workshops are highly demanded. He has also ordained and fathered several men and women into their own ministries.

In 1999, Dr. Ellis found The Conquerors Community Development
Corporation (CCDC), a mission designed to elevate the quality of life for the Southwest Philadelphia community through economic development, child development, technological awareness, spiritual/cultural programs and health initiatives. Dr. Ellis' vision is to further institute employment services, daycare services, housing and community revitalization programs, health-related projects and life skills to empower the community.

In March 2004, Dr. Ellis received his honorary Doctorate of Divinity Degree from Saint Thomas Christian College in Jacksonville, Florida. Dr. Ellis' contributions have been applauded throughout the city by the media, governing officials and with numerous awards. He is an author of many books, his latest bestseller, "My Angel, My Ally".
